More about Advanced Diploma of Myotherapy

The Advanced Diploma of Myotherapy is a highly regarded qualification for those pursuing a rewarding career in the health and wellness sector. In New South Wales, aspiring myotherapists can find various training providers that specialise in delivering this comprehensive program. Myotherapy focuses on the assessment and treatment of musculoskeletal pain, making skilled practitioners essential in settings such as clinics, sports teams, and wellness centres. With this diploma, you can embark on exciting career paths, such as becoming a myotherapist, pain management consultant, or massage therapist.
